Subject: [PATCH 24/25] netfilter: nft_compat: put back match/target module if init fail

From: Liping Zhang <liping.zhang@...eadtrum.com>

If the user specify the invalid NFTA_MATCH_INFO/NFTA_TARGET_INFO attr
or memory alloc fail, we should call module_put to the related match
or target. Otherwise, we cannot remove the module even nobody use it.

 net/netfilter/nft_compat.c | 32 ++++++++++++++++++++++++--------
 1 file changed, 24 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/netfilter/nft_compat.c b/net/netfilter/nft_compat.c
index 6228c42..2e07cec 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/nft_compat.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/nft_compat.c
@@ -634,6 +634,7 @@ nft_match_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	struct xt_match *match;
 	char *mt_name;
 	u32 rev, family;
+	int err;
 
 	if (tb[NFTA_MATCH_NAME] == NULL ||
 	    tb[NFTA_MATCH_REV] == NULL ||
@@ -660,13 +661,17 @@ nft_match_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	if (IS_ERR(match))
 		return ERR_PTR(-ENOENT);
 
-	if (match->matchsize > nla_len(tb[NFTA_MATCH_INFO]))
-		return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
+	if (match->matchsize > nla_len(tb[NFTA_MATCH_INFO])) {
+		err = -EINVAL;
+		goto err;
+	}
 
 	/* This is the first time we use this match, allocate operations */
 	nft_match = kzalloc(sizeof(struct nft_xt), GFP_KERNEL);
-	if (nft_match == NULL)
-		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
+	if (nft_match == NULL) {
+		err = -ENOMEM;
+		goto err;
+	}
 
 	nft_match->ops.type = &nft_match_type;
 	nft_match->ops.size = NFT_EXPR_SIZE(XT_ALIGN(match->matchsize));
@@ -680,6 +685,9 @@ nft_match_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	list_add(&nft_match->head, &nft_match_list);
 
 	return &nft_match->ops;
+err:
+	module_put(match->me);
+	return ERR_PTR(err);
 }
 
 static void nft_match_release(void)
@@ -717,6 +725,7 @@ nft_target_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	struct xt_target *target;
 	char *tg_name;
 	u32 rev, family;
+	int err;
 
 	if (tb[NFTA_TARGET_NAME] == NULL ||
 	    tb[NFTA_TARGET_REV] == NULL ||
@@ -743,13 +752,17 @@ nft_target_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	if (IS_ERR(target))
 		return ERR_PTR(-ENOENT);
 
-	if (target->targetsize > nla_len(tb[NFTA_TARGET_INFO]))
-		return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
+	if (target->targetsize > nla_len(tb[NFTA_TARGET_INFO])) {
+		err = -EINVAL;
+		goto err;
+	}
 
 	/* This is the first time we use this target, allocate operations */
 	nft_target = kzalloc(sizeof(struct nft_xt), GFP_KERNEL);
-	if (nft_target == NULL)
-		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
+	if (nft_target == NULL) {
+		err = -ENOMEM;
+		goto err;
+	}
 
 	nft_target->ops.type = &nft_target_type;
 	nft_target->ops.size = NFT_EXPR_SIZE(XT_ALIGN(target->targetsize));
@@ -767,6 +780,9 @@ nft_target_select_ops(const struct nft_ctx *ctx,
 	list_add(&nft_target->head, &nft_target_list);
 
 	return &nft_target->ops;
+err:
+	module_put(target->me);
+	return ERR_PTR(err);
 }
